Trenchless Sewer Repair in Lakeland, FL

Trenchless sewer repair is a modern method used to fix damaged or deteriorating sewer lines without the need for extensive excavation. This technique typically involves inserting specialized equipment through existing access points to locate and repair issues such as cracks, leaks, or collapsed pipes. It is suitable for a variety of projects, including replacing old sewer lines, repairing broken or corroded pipes, and resolving blockages caused by tree roots or debris. Property owners interested in this service often want to understand how the process minimizes disruption to landscaping, driveways, or walkways, and how it can provide a faster, less invasive solution compared to traditional excavation methods.

Before requesting trenchless sewer repair, homeowners should consider the scope of the project, including the location and condition of the existing sewer lines. It’s helpful to have an assessment of the pipe material and accessibility to determine if this method is appropriate. Property owners usually want to know about the potential impact on their property, the expected longevity of the repair, and any preparations needed prior to work. Understanding these aspects can help ensure the repair process aligns with their needs and expectations.

Project Types

Common Trenchless Sewer Repair Jobs

Pipe lining - a trenchless method that installs a new pipe inside the existing sewer line without excavation.

Pipe bursting - a technique that replaces damaged pipes by breaking them apart and pulling in new pipe material.

Cured-in-place pipe (CIPP) - a process that creates a seamless, durable pipe within the current sewer system.

Spot repairs - targeted fixes for specific pipe sections to address leaks or cracks without full replacement.

Main sewer line repair - addressing blockages or damage to the primary sewer line with minimal disruption.

Drain lining - restoring damaged or cracked drain pipes efficiently without digging up the property.

FAQ

Trenchless Sewer Repair Questions

What is trenchless sewer repair? Trenchless sewer repair is a method that fixes damaged sewer lines without digging extensive trenches, minimizing property disruption.

When is trenchless sewer repair recommended? It is suitable for repairing cracked, broken, or collapsed sewer pipes, especially when traditional excavation is challenging or undesirable.

Are there different types of trenchless sewer repair? Yes, common methods include pipe lining (cured-in-place pipe) and pipe bursting, both designed to restore sewer lines efficiently.

What are the benefits of trenchless sewer repair? This approach reduces excavation, shortens repair time, and limits damage to landscaping and property structures.
